Building Cross-Functional Collaboration Skills
Effective supply chain stewardship depends on the ability to collaborate across diverse functions such as procurement, finance, operations, technology, and sustainability. Each function brings unique priorities and constraints, and misalignment among them can disrupt even the most efficient processes. Professionals who intentionally build cross-functional collaboration skills become connectors who translate goals into shared understanding. This capability enhances both operational performance and career satisfaction.
Developing collaboration begins with learning the language and incentives of other teams. By understanding what success looks like for finance or technology colleagues, supply chain professionals can frame proposals in ways that resonate broadly. Active listening, clear communication, and empathy reduce friction and foster trust. Over time, this trust enables faster decision-making and more innovative problem-solving across organizational boundaries.
Cross-functional collaboration also positions professionals for leadership roles. Leaders who can unify diverse teams around common objectives are better equipped to guide complex transformations. This skill not only strengthens organizational outcomes but also reinforces a sense of purpose and fulfillment in one’s career journey.

Embedding Sustainability Into Everyday Decisions
Sustainability in supply chain stewardship is not limited to high-level initiatives or corporate statements; it is reinforced through everyday decisions made across sourcing, production, and distribution. Professionals who embed sustainability into routine choices contribute to long-term value creation while aligning operations with environmental and social responsibility. This integration transforms sustainability from an obligation into a guiding principle for action.
Embedding sustainability requires awareness of trade-offs and lifecycle impacts. Decisions about suppliers, materials, and transportation methods influence emissions, labor conditions, and resource use. Supply chain professionals who evaluate options holistically can balance cost, quality, and responsibility more effectively. Over time, these practices build resilient systems that withstand regulatory and market pressures.
As sustainability becomes central to business strategy, professionals who champion responsible decision-making strengthen their leadership potential. This commitment enhances personal fulfillment by connecting daily work to broader global outcomes, reinforcing the role of supply chain stewardship as a force for positive change.
